How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Durant Manor?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Durant Manor Studio Apartments | $2,100 | $1,450 | $2,406 |
Durant Manor 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,251 | $1,424 | $2,898 |
| Durant Manor 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,695 | $1,900 | $4,898 |
| Durant Manor 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,059 | $2,600 | $3,695 |
| Durant Manor 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,904 | $3,650 | $4,413 |
